Unforgettable Awaits: Marriott’s Bold Leap into Luxury Safari Experiences

Marriott International has made a commendable move by unveiling its plans for the Mapito Safari Camp, an exquisite addition to its Autograph Collection. This striking development not only signifies Marriott’s dedication to expanding luxury accommodations but also elegantly intertwines nature with opulence. The camp, strategically located along the Great Migration route in Tanzania’s Serengeti, aims to provide a unique and enriching experience for guests, blending the thrill of safari adventures with the comfort anticipated from a global hospitality leader.

Pioneering Comfort in the Wild

Set to debut in the third quarter, the Mapito Safari Camp promises 16 lavish tented suites, including a two-bedroom villa where luxury meets wilderness. The design ethos of these accommodations—complete with outdoor decks and fire pits—is clearly aimed at creating an immersive experience. The retractable roofs for stargazing are particularly noteworthy, allowing guests to enjoy the night sky in all its natural glory. Such features emphasize Marriott’s commitment to elevating the safari experience, fostering a blend of wildlife wonder and comfort that many travelers crave but often find elusive in typical safari lodges.

Strategic Wildlife Engagement

Positioned between Central Serengeti and the western migration corridor, the camp is ideally situated for wildlife enthusiasts and photographers. The timing of its opening—aligning with the Great Migration from May to July—only enhances its appeal, beckoning tourists eager to witness this grand spectacle of nature. Furthermore, the camp’s promise of year-round views of the “Big Five” provides assurance for wanderers passionate about capturing authentic wildlife moments. Innovative Amenities to Enrich Experience

Besides stunning accommodations, the camp plans to offer an array of exciting amenities, such as a spa, fitness center, swimming pool, and various dining options, including The Boma, which draws inspiration from traditional African gatherings.
